Output d03ff03d6d931c7257c5b74e25c158c58bbf93bd2d22132e6305b81eaa629f06:0

value
17442800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b7a8b6fce4d18a09bab89846f543ef2b1d3604 OP_EQUAL
address
3EhdtdwGAnXkmRj11p3AJYYUpwZWhXB8v7
transaction
d03ff03d6d931c7257c5b74e25c158c58bbf93bd2d22132e6305b81eaa629f06
spent
true